2010-02-10 114 views

回答

9

简短答案是“否”。

在您读取.emacs的时候,选择是使用图形还是非图形显示。

也许一个外壳程序的别名将更好地满足您的需求

alias emacs 'emacs -nw' 

您可以通过在你的.emacs的顶部添加

(y-or-n-p "Sourcing .emacs...") 

验证这一点,并运行的图形和非图形的变体Emacs,无论你在Emacs出现之后得到提示(图形或非图形)。

+1

“课程我鄙视的别名,而将使用shell函数: emacs的(){ 命令 emacs的 “$ @” -nw } – offby1 2010-02-11 01:39:31

+0

所以...答案是 “否”? – 2010-02-11 17:17:37

+0

@Carlos Touche。更新。 – 2010-02-11 17:46:09

2

要记住的另一件事是,大多数Linux发行版都有一个包,它允许在没有图形支持的情况下安装emacs。在基于Debian的发行版中,这是emacs-nox。此外,由于emacs23的开发已经完成,emacs现在有一个守护进程模式,因此您可以使用emacsclient连接到一个正在运行的emacs实例。如果您希望同时使用图形客户端和非图形客户端,这可能会给您一些灵活性。

相关问题